Solution

The correct options are
A C = 2
C C = 7
Divisibility of 5 states that a number is divisible by 5 if it has 0 or 5 in its ones place.

76C is divisible by 5 if C = 0 or 5
Since, it leaves a remainder 2, C = 0 + 2 or 5 + 2.
C = 2 or 7
For C = 2 and 7, 76C ÷ 5 will leave remainder 2.
